Description
Triple Crossing Brewing is located in the heart of Richmond, VA. The original 7 barrel brewery is located in Downtown Richmond and the newer pizza kitchen brewpub/production facility located in Fulton. Triple Crossing focuses on hop forward beers, lagers and all things barrel related.
